English Important Questions Chapter 4.3 “Chasing the Sea Monster” Class 7 Maharashtra Board

Important Question For All Chapters – English Class 7

Short Questions


1. Who is the narrator of the story?

Answer : Professor Aronnax.

2. What is the name of the ship in the story?

Answer : The Abraham Lincoln.

3. What time did the monster reappear?

Answer : Near two o’clock in the morning.

4. What is the profession of Jules Verne?

Answer : He is a French writer.

5. What is Jules Verne known as?

Answer : The ‘Father of Science Fiction.’

6. What did the animal do to the frigate?

Answer : It circled the ship and covered it in luminous electricity.

7. What was Ned Land sharpening?

Answer : His harpoon.

8. What did the cannon shot do to the monster?

Answer : It bounced off its hard surface.

9. How did the monster react after the harpoon struck it?

Answer : It created two large waterspouts.

10. What did the crew use to try to catch the monster?

Answer : Harpoons and cannons.

11. What material did the crew think the monster’s body was covered in?

Answer : Six-inch armor plates.

12. What part of the ship did the commander order to use the cannon?

Answer : The bow.

13.How long did the chase last before the frigate slowed down?

Answer : About three-quarters of an hour.

14. What glowed brightly on the monster?

Answer : Its electric light.

15. What is the frigate’s name derived from?

Answer : President Abraham Lincoln.


Long Questions


1. How did Commander Farragut react to the monster’s presence?

Answer : He decided not to take risks in the darkness and planned to confront it in daylight.

2. Why was the crew unable to sleep at night?

Answer : They were on high alert, watching the monster’s movements and preparing for action.

3. What did the crew do when the monster reappeared in the morning?

Answer : They loaded their weapons, including harpoons and cannons, and prepared to attack.

4. Why did the commander offer $500 to the crew?

Answer : To motivate someone to successfully hit the monster with a cannonball.

5. How did the chase affect the frigate’s condition?

Answer : The ship sped so fast that its masts trembled, and it struggled to catch up with the monster.

6. What happened when the harpoon struck the monster?

Answer : It caused an electric reaction, and waterspouts crashed onto the ship, causing damage.

7. What emotions did the crew feel when the monster disappeared?

Answer : They experienced both fear and hope, unsure of the monster’s intentions.

8. What made the animal seem unearthly to the crew?

Answer : Its glowing body, immense size, and speed were unlike anything found on Earth.

9. Why did the harpooner find it hard to strike the monster?

Answer : The monster moved swiftly and eluded the crew’s attempts to attack.

10. What was the final result of the encounter with the monster?

Answer : The monster damaged the ship, and the narrator was thrown overboard into the sea.

Study Abroad

Study in Australia: Australia is known for its vibrant student life and world-class education in fields like engineering, business, health sciences, and arts. Major student hubs include Sydney, Melbourne, and Brisbane. Top universities: University of Sydney, University of Melbourne, ANU, UNSW.

Study in Canada: Canada offers affordable education, a multicultural environment, and work opportunities for international students. Top universities: University of Toronto, UBC, McGill, University of Alberta.

Study in the UK: The UK boasts prestigious universities and a wide range of courses. Students benefit from rich cultural experiences and a strong alumni network. Top universities: Oxford, Cambridge, Imperial College, LSE.

Study in Germany: Germany offers high-quality education, especially in engineering and technology, with many low-cost or tuition-free programs. Top universities: LMU Munich, TUM, University of Heidelberg.

Study in the USA: The USA has a diverse educational system with many research opportunities and career advancement options. Top universities: Harvard, MIT, Stanford, UC Berkeley
